Napkin Holder Plan
Cutting the Parts
Page 3 of 5

P2P3P4P4

Step 1 - Cut the Base and Sides
First we will cut the base and two sides to the appropriate size. The dimensions for these parts are listed on the templates (Templates are available on Page 1).
Cut the Base and Sides
Click to Enlarge Image.
Step 2 - Shape the Sides
The next step is to shape the edges of both the bottom piece and the two side pieces. For this you can use a router, sander, or as pictured to the right, a router table. If you don't have a router you can always round over the edges with a piece of sandpaper.
Route the Bottom and Sides
Click to Enlarge Image.
Step 3 - Drill the Sides with a Forstner Bit
To form the channel that the rod rides in, we begin by drilling a 1 1/8" hole with a forstner bit (See the side piece template for exact positioning.). The reason that we use a forstner bit is that it will give us a smoother and cleaner hole than a spade bit or hole saw.
Drill the Sides with a Forstner Bit
Click to Enlarge Image.
Step 4 - Cut the Lines
Next, draw two parallel lines up to the edges of the hole (See template).  Use a saw (such as a bandsaw) to cut out the lines.
Cut the Lines

Center Section Cut Out
Click to Enlarge Image.

Step 5 - Sand the parts
Thoroughly sand all edges and surfaces of the napkin holder parts before you move on to the next section.
